Cache-ControlCache-Control 是最重要的规则。这个字段用于指定所有缓存机制在整个请求/响应链中必须服从的指令。这些指令指定用于阻止缓存对请求或响应造成不利干扰的行为。这些指令 通常覆盖默认缓存算法。缓存指令是单向的,即请求中存在一个指令并不意味着响应中将存在同一个指令。cache-control 定义是:Cache-Control = “Cache-Control” “
Varnish进程及存储Varnish进程结构Varnish管理进程varnishd启动之后有两个进程:管理进程(父进程ID为1)和子进程(父进程ID为管理进程ID).# ps -ef | grep varnishd | grep -v grep管理进程每隔几秒探测一下子进程的活动.如果在一定的时间之内,没有获得回复,管理进程就会杀死子进程并重启它.管理进程的日志将会记录到syslog.由于管理进
本文为收集所有varnish3.0以上问题及解决方法,目的为了方便查询。分原创及转载两部分。转载部分来源地址:http://blog.chinaunix.net/uid-20375449-id-3701202.html 作者:shanxueyi1. 高流量情况下iptables丢包ip_conntrack: table full, dropping packet.按网上常规方法,只修改/etc/s
十六、DirectorsDirector(不知道怎么翻译合适,所以就保留了)你也可以将几个后端分组为一组后端。这些组称为directors。这可以提高性能和灵活度。你可以定义几个后端,并把它们归到一个director中?123456backend server1 {.host = "192.168.0.10";}backend server2{.host = "192.168.0.10";}现在创
十、VaryVary头信息是web服务器发送的,代表什么引起了HTTP对象的变化。可以通过Accept-Encoding这样的头信息弄明白。当服务器发出”Vary:Accept-Encoding”,它等于告诉varnish,需要对每个来自客户端的不同的Accept-Encoding缓存不同的版本。所以,如果客户端只接收gzip编码。varnish就不会提供deflate编码的页面版本。如果Acce
第二部分:应用篇当我们部署好之后,自然就是要学习怎么使用,Linux下,尤其是Server的Linux怎么可能有GUI呢。所以,学习配置文件的语法和控制台就很关键了。下面是要的学习内容目录,我们还是依次进行。Backend serversStarting VarnishLogging in VarnishSizing your cachePut Varnish on port 80Varnish
作者:AnyKoro本教程为官方教程的完整翻译。并做了一定总结、整理。整个Varnish的学习需要分成两个部分,PART1:部署篇,PART2:应用篇第一部分:部署篇作为一个Server Service,部署是最基本的,同时也没有太多需要说明的。按照官方的教程,一运行便可了。但是需要注意的是,–perfix什么的,具体怎么设置的,可要好好的记住,否则,以后要查起来,可就没有头绪了。另外,装了什么样
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号